REEL-STREAM TAKES AFFORDABLE UNCOMPRESSED HD ACQUISITION TO NEW LEVEL
New Product Extracts Pure Uncompressed 14-bit RGB HD Video from Panasonic’s AG-HVX200(TM)
West Lafayette, Indiana (March 26, 2007) - Reel-Stream LLC today announced the Hydra(TM) Uncompressed Digital Acquisition system for the Panasonic AG-HVX200(TM) camera. Expanding the capabilities of their current AndromedaTM product for the Panasonic AG-DVX100(TM) camera, Hydra(TM) offers full bandwidth RGB (4:4:4) uncompressed digital video recording at 14-bit (linear RGB) color and up to 60 progressive frames per second when installed on the HVX200. The system extracts pure uncompressed 2K RGB data available directly from the digital imaging block of the camera, bypassing all internal compression, decimation, color conversions and other processes. The result is a video capture with increased resolution, increased latitude and zero compression artifacts for an image purity that rivals much more expensive high-end cameras at a very affordable price.
Both Hydra(TM) and Andromeda(TM) reside entirely inside the host camera, only adding a few grams of weight. The only visible change is the addition of an external port for the uncompressed data. All original functions of the cameras remain unaffected.
Both systems are bundled with the SculptorHD(TM) software solution which provides a front-end for recording the uncompressed video stream, serves as a multi-function monitor and handles the process of batch exporting captured raw footage into multiple media formats. SculptorHD(TM) is currently available as a Universal Binary for Mac OS X. Also included is xLUT(TM), a full-featured camera-independent Look-Up Table editor capable of exporting in a variety of LUT file formats.
HydraTM for the Panasonic AG-HVX200(TM)is scheduled for release during the second half of 2007, with support for other cameras to follow. Andromeda(TM) for the Panasonic AG-DVX100(TM) is currently available and can be ordered directly from the Reel-Stream website.

The following is a list of preliminary specifications for the Hydra Uncompressed Digital Acquisition System on the Panasonic AG-HVX200. A more elaborate supported mode matrix will be available by NAB.
The Hydra system was designed to be camera platform independent, so the characteristics of the output are defined by the hardware capabilities of the host camera. The preliminary specs listed here are for an HVX200 as a host system.
RECORD MODES:
Full RGB(4:4:4) only
COLOR BIT DEPTH MODES:
14-bit RGB Linear
12-bit RGB via Record LUT
10-bit RGB via Record LUT
8-bit RGB via Record LUT
DIGITAL DYNAMIC RANGE:
Up to 86dB
(Photographic latitude test results to be posted soon)
NATIVE FRAME SIZE:
2100 x 1090
SUPPORTED FRAME RATES:
2fps to 60fps (All native framerates in the HVX200)
INCLUDED SOFTWARE:
SculptorHD 2.0, xLUT (Universal Binary for Mac OS X)
VIDEO INGEST INTERFACE:
Gigabit Ethernet (over CAT 5e or 6 cable) to any Intel Mac computer running SculptorHD 2.0.
